The , edited by Richard A. Helms and David J. Quan (with roots in the work of Eric T. Herfindal), is a cornerstone reference for pharmacy and medical students, as well as practicing clinicians. Spanning over 2,700 pages , it provides a comprehensive framework for rational drug therapy and the clinical management of diverse disease states. Core Content and Scope

The 8th edition of Textbook of Therapeutics by Helms, Quan, and Herfindal is designed to assist clinicians in optimizing drug therapy for patients.
, edited by Richard A. Helms and David J. Quan, is a comprehensive medical resource often required for advanced pharmacology programs. Published in by Lippincott Williams & Wilkins, it contains 2,780 pages of detailed drug therapy information. Accessing the Book
